2-(2-phenoxyethylsulfanyl)-5-[4-(trifluoromethyl)phenyl]-1,3,4-oxadiazole

Also Known As: Bionet1_003913, 11P-181, phenyl 2-({5-[4-(trifluoromethyl)phenyl]-1,3,4-oxadiazol-2-yl}sulfanyl)ethyl ether, 2-(2-phenoxyethylsulfanyl)-5-[4-(trifluoromethyl)phenyl]-1,3,4-oxadiazole, 2-[(2-phenoxyethyl)sulfanyl]-5-[4-(trifluoromethyl)phenyl]-1,3,4-oxadiazole

CAS: 477857-08-2
Molecular Formula C17H13F3N2O2S
Molecular Weight 366.06 g/mol
LogP 4.9265
Topological Polar Surface Area 48.15 Ų
Hydrogen Bond Donors 0
Hydrogen Bond Acceptors 5
Rotatable Bonds 6
Exact Mass 366.06497
Heavy Atoms 25
Complexity 804.7652

Chemical Identifiers

CAS Number 477857-08-2
SMILES C1=CC=C(C=C1)OCCSC2=NN=C(O2)C3=CC=C(C=C3)C(F)(F)F

Property Insights of Bionet1_003913

The XLogP value of 4.9265 indicates that Bionet1_003913 is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. With a topological polar surface area (TPSA) of 48.15 Ų, Bionet1_003913 ex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, Bionet1_003913 has 0 hydrogen bond donor(s) and 5 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
